1 Robert Jay Couch 70 a resident of Summers, Arkansas, formerly of Southern California, passed away December 1, 2009 in Summers, Arkansas. He was born March 24, 1939 at Chicago, llinois, the son of Earl and Lillian "Dolly" Schiff Couch. Robert was previously involved with the Cub Scouts, ndian Guides and the Boy Scouts. Survivors include his wife, Rhoda Couch of the home; two sons, Michael Couch of Summers, Arkansas, Robert Couch and Daniel Couch of Southern California; two daughters, Linda Sunbury and Joanie Dhondt of Missouri; seven grandchildren and one great grandchild.
